文本数据分析方法与应用主要包括

  • 发布:2024-04-19 18:20

文本数据分析方法与应用

随着大数据时代的来临,文本数据作为非结构化数据的重要组成部分,其价值逐渐被挖掘和利用。文本数据分析,即对文本数据进行处理、分析和挖掘,以提取有价值的信息和知识。本文将介绍文本数据分析的主要方法与应用。

一、文本数据的预处理

预处理是文本数据分析的第一步,主要包括分词、去停用词、词干提取等。分词是将文本切分成一个个独立的词语或短语,以便后续的分析处理。去停用词则是去除文本中无实际意义的词,如“的”、“了”等。词干提取则是将词语简化,提取其核心意思。

二、特征提取

特征提取是从文本中提取出能够代表该文本的特征,如关键词、主题、情感等。常见的特征提取方法有基于词袋模型的TF-IDF、TexRak等。TF-IDF(Term Frequecy-Iverse Docume Frequecy)是一种常用的权重计算方法,用于衡量一个词在文档中的重要性。TexRak则是一种基于图的排序算法,用于提取文本中的关键词。

三、文本分类与聚类

文本分类是根据文本的内容将其划分到预定义的类别中,常见的分类算法有朴素贝叶斯、支持向量机等。文本聚类则是将相似的文本聚集在一起,常见的聚类算法有K-meas、层次聚类等。通过对文本进行分类和聚类,可以发现文本之间的内在联系,为信息检索、主题发现等提供支持。

四、情感分析

情感分析是通过对文本的情感倾向进行分析,以了解用户对某一事物的态度和情感。情感分析在舆情监控、产品评价等领域有着广泛的应用。常见的情感分析方法有基于规则的方法和基于机器学习的方法。基于规则的方法通过定义情感词典和规则来判定文本的情感倾向,而基于机器学习的方法则需要训练大量的标注数据来进行模型训练。

五、主题模型

主题模型是一种用于发现文本主题的统计模型,如LDA(Lae Dirichle Allocaio)和PLSA(Probabilisic Lae Semaic Aalysis)。主题模型能够从大量文本中挖掘出潜在的主题,并给出每个主题所包含的关键词。主题模型在新闻报道分析、学术论文领域分类等领域有着广泛的应用。

六、应用场景

1. 舆情监控:通过对网络上的评论、新闻等文本数据进行实时监控和分析,了解公众对某一事件或产品的态度和情感倾向,为企业决策提供支持。

2. 推荐系统:通过对用户的历史行为和评论等文本数据进行挖掘和分析,了解用户的兴趣和偏好,为其推荐相关产品或服务。

3. 自然语言处理:通过对自然语言文本进行分词、词性标注、句法分析等处理,提高自然语言处理的准确率和效率。

4. 信息检索:通过对网页、文献等大量文本数据进行挖掘和分析,快速准确地找到用户所需的信息。

5. 商业智能:通过对企业内部文本数据进行分析和处理,发现企业的运营情况和未来趋势,为企业的决策提供有力支持。

文本数据分析作为一种从大量非结构化文本数据中提取有价值信息和知识的方法,已经在各个领域得到了广泛的应用。随着技术的不断进步和应用场景的不断拓展,文本数据分析将会发挥出更大的价值。

相关文章

热门推荐